Lebanese Speaker praises Armenian community’s role in country’s development

On October 5, Armenian Foreign Minister Edward Nalbandian met with Nabih Berri, the speaker of Lebanese parliament, currently in Yerevan on an official visit.

Welcoming the guest, Mr. Nalbandian gave high assessment between Armenia-Lebanon friendly ties.

During the meeting, the parties focused on a number of political, trade and economic issues, mutually stressing the importance of inter-parliamentary cooperation in the development of bilateral relations.

Mr. Berri noted the role of Lebanese Armenian community in political, economic and cultural life of the country.

Discussion of South Caucasus conflicts was also on meeting agenda, Foreign Ministry’s press service reported.
